Obituary for SMSGT Richard Edward Haskins

SMSGT Richard Edward  Haskins
Senior Master Sergeant Richard Edward Haskins, 80, of Longmeadow, MA entered into eternal rest on Wednesday October 26, 2016. Richard was the beloved husband of 58 years to the late Barbara Ann (McIntire) Haskins. He was born on April 8, 1936 in Brockton, MA, son of the late Malcolm and Zilpha (Mills) Haskins. Richard was a graduate of W. Bridgewater H.S. and played Varsity football, basketball and baseball all during high school. He had resided in Longmeadow for the past 43 years and in Burlington, MA prior to that.
Richard served his country proudly with the US Air Force and made a career with the Dept. of Defense for 35 years. He served during the Korean & Vietnam Wars and Dessert Storm after active duty he enlisted with the US Air Force Reserves, having received various medals, awards and citations. In his leisure time he enjoyed RV camping (Happy Sam RV Club), Umpiring Softball, High School and Adult Leagues, Refereeing, Skeet Shooting and was inducted into the US Hall of Fame. He loved his dogs.
